Merger Agreement Approvals Clarity and Predictability Act
Summary
HR6570, the Merger Agreement Approvals Clarity and Predictability Act, is a procedural bill requiring a GAO study on the use of commitments and conditions in bank merger applications. It has been reported from committee and placed on the Union Calendar but remains far from enactment. No direct market impact is expected.

Full Analysis
The bill, introduced by Rep. Fitzgerald (R-WI) and referred to the House Financial Services Committee, was reported amended and placed on the Union Calendar in February 2026. It mandates a GAO study—not new regulations or funding—on how federal banking agencies (Federal Reserve, OCC, FDIC, NCUA) use commitments and conditions in merger applications for insured depository institutions. The study is due six months after enactment. This legislative step is early-stage: the bill must still pass the House, Senate, and be signed into law. No money is authorized or appropriated. Given the bill's procedural nature, there are no direct winners or losers. If enacted, the study could ultimately lead to legislative or regulatory changes affecting bank M&A, but that is years away.
